Madd54 is referring to a type of joke in the English-speaking world. The jokes always follow the same formula, involving a person knocking at a door, and the person inside responding with 'Who's there?' So the joke proceeds, usually involving word-play of a kind which would make it difficult for a non-native English speaker to understand.
